## Tracing Setup for Plugin Authors — Threadline

Every request through the Threadline mesh carries a trace context header that your plugin must propagate unchanged; dropping it breaks span stitching downstream. Set TRACE_SAMPLE_RATE to 0.1 during development. Your plugin authenticates span uploads to the collector with a token, set on the following line:

secret setting of fawep-tagaf: ARCHIVE_KEY3=ce5

**TICKET: Drift between prod and canary — Glimmerbatch stale-cache postmortem**

Quick recap for the sync: the stale-cache bug from last Tuesday was config drift, plain and simple. Canary had the new TTL logic, prod didn't, and the invalidation fanout silently no-oped. Tova rolled everything forward Thursday. To keep us honest, here's what prod is actually running right now after the reconciliation.

deployment values, yadup-kadug:
[sorys]
port = 5672
team = noveth
host = sorys.orvexcorp.example
region = south-4
access_code = ac_deddc1
timeout_ms = 1500

Ticket: Roof-terrace door, Larkspan Building, level 9, continues to jam in the closed position, particularly after rain. Team assistants should not force it; the frame has already been bent once. Until the joiner from Fennick Maintenance attends on Thursday, please use the east stairwell door instead. That door requires the access code shown below.

door code, kawip-bagap: bdg-HQEWH-4

For finance. Effective next quarter, marketing spend drops 18%. Cuts: trade events (Fenwick Expo withdrawn), print campaigns ended, agency retainer with Brightlark Media reduced by half. Digital spend holds flat. Headcount unaffected this cycle. Savings redirect to the Orvane platform rebuild. Regional leads notified; pushback expected from the Calderon territory team. Reforecast due in ten days. Risk: pipeline softness in two quarters. Mitigation plan attached. Review the restricted note that follows before circulating.

internal memo for kawip-hadug: Headcount on the Wenwyn team goes from 7 to 140 by the end of January. Gross margin on Wenwyn came in at 20 percent against a plan of 15 percent.